"My canal Config.anom" typically refers to a specialized configuration file used in automated web-testing and credential-checking software like or SilverBullet . These files are designed to interact specifically with the myCANAL streaming service to test login authentication and account details. What is a .anom Config?

: It automates the "request" and "parse" steps—sending login data to the myCANAL servers and interpreting the response to see if the credentials are valid.

: Developers and cybersecurity professionals use these tools for penetration testing to find vulnerabilities in a website's authentication system.

: These files are frequently traded on underground forums for credential stuffing attacks, where hackers try lists of leaked usernames and passwords to hijack accounts.
